20/20 Savvy Vision: Our 'Top 20' 2020 Investment Outlook Papers

Looser global monetary policy, the ratification of Phase 1 of the US-China trade deal, and lessening recession risk all point towards a rosier outcome for global GDP growth in 2020, yet the political environment remains somewhat unstable. As Iranian tensions flare, the world is left to wonder how best to quell the unexpected physical and ideological wildfires that might arise, as well as their accompanying spikes of volatility. Meanwhile, investors are left attempting to properly account for these tail risk events within their projections for global asset class returns. 

In our 'Top 20' investment outlook papers listed below, the world's leading asset managers provide their vision on how the year 2020 is likely to unfold.
